SWIFT, Jonathan. THE TRAVELS OF LEMUEL GULLIVER. [New York]: Limited 
Editions Club, 1929. Quarto (7-3/8" x 11-1/8") bound in natural linen 
backed with pigskin leather. The first book of the press and apparently 
the first illustrated edition of this classic satire aimed at adults. 
Copy #295 of 1500 illustrated by Alexander King and SIGNED by the artist 
on the colophon page. A few spots of mild rubbing to the spine. Near 
Fine in a Good slipcase, completely intact but worn. (#015575)        $500
